>> Hi Bryan,
>> Definitely. I understand their desire not to divulge release dates,
>> information about a project in development, but on the other hand they are
>>
>> too quiet about their plans for the future as well. They haven't had a
>> release since 2004, and Chillingham appears to have problems on newer
>> Windows versions. When asked if they plan to upgrade their games to be
>> more Windows Vista and Window 7 compatible dead silence. That's not
>> exactly good technical support or customer service in my opinion. What if
>> I were a new customer wanting to know if their games would work on my
>> brand new computer running Windows 7?
>> The problem is made even worse by the fact they do not offer demos.
>> Therefore some new blind gamer who finds out about Bavisoft may purchase
>> one of their games, and find out only after it is too late that he/she got
>>
>> an incompatible product, and that Bavisoft fails to offer upgrades and
>> technical support.  That's a raw deal if you ask me.
